L1 Enterprises, Inc. 618 W. Patrick St. Frederick, MD 21701 UEI SAM: RK5ZXQ77CN73
The Central Arkansas Veterans Healthcare System (CAVHS) has a requirement to upgrade the SPECTRALIS Software (HEYEX2).
The North American Industry Classification (NAICS) code for this acquisition is 513210 Other Computer-Related Services. The size standard is 150 employees.
This procurement is being conducted under the Revolutionary FAR Overhaul (RFO)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Parts 8 Required Sources of Supplies and Services and FAR 5.001 Notice of Proposed Contract Action. This notice is not a request for quotes, but rather a NOI to Sole Source.
The anticipated award date is 01 June 2026. The Government intends to award a Firm-Fixed-price contract.
Please note that this is not a request for competitive quotes and is being posted for informational purposes only. The Government does not anticipate receiving responses to this notice. However, interested parties who disagree with this action may submit a letter of interest that demonstrates your firm s technical expertise, original equipment manufacturer (OEM) authorization letter that outlines their ability to sell/distribute OEM software for upgrades, and personnel OEM training/certifications to perform services. Interested vendors shall communicate how its software upgrades are compatible with the SPECTRALIS Software system. The Government reserves the right to verify and request additional documentation submitted.
Interested parties shall identify their interests, provide OEM authorization, personnel certifications/training as mentioned in Section V of this document, and demonstrate that their capabilities meet the Government s requirements. They must respond to this notice within fifteen (15) days of the publication of this notice. Any response to this notice must show clear and convincing evidence that competition would be advantageous to the Government.
Interested parties may identify their interest solely via email to Contract Specialist, Carmyn E. Williams at Carmyn.Williams@va.gov no later than 04 May 2026 at 10:00 AM Central Standard Time (CST). When responding to this announcement, respondents should include 36C25626Q0669 Notice of Intent in the subject line.
Late responses may not be accepted. No telephone inquiries will be accepted, nor will phone calls be returned. Only emailed responses will be considered. Information received will be utilized solely for determining whether to conduct competitive procurement. A determination not to compete with this proposed acquisition based upon response to this notice is at the sole discretion of the Government.
